Table 1

Tissue uptake clearance of the glycosylated derivatives of AVP

TissueCLup,app (ml/min/g Tissue)
AVPGlc-O-C8-AVPGal-O-C8-AVPMan-O-C8-AVPMan(α)-O-C8-AVP2dGlc-O-C8-AVP
Heart0.048  ± 0.0030.032  ± 0.0020.032  ± 0.0010.032  ± 0.0020.041  ± 0.0020.036  ± 0.001
Lung0.101  ± 0.0110.084  ± 0.0340.060  ± 0.0020.047  ± 0.0010.063  ± 0.0030.061  ± 0.003
Spleen0.108  ± 0.0030.030  ± 0.0020.035  ± 0.0010.034  ± 0.0010.039  ± 0.0010.038  ± 0.001
Kidney0.488  ± 0.0402.430  ± 0.1540.361  ± 0.0393.428  ± 0.2350.669  ± 0.0123.601  ± 0.134
Muscle0.030  ± 0.0010.017  ± 0.0060.020  ± 0.0010.026  ± 0.0030.025  ± 0.0020.019  ± 0.001
Brain0.014  ± 0.0010.007  ± 0.0010.007  ± 0.0010.007  ± 0.0000.008  ± 0.0010.008  ± 0.000
BM0.097  ± 0.0070.060  ± 0.0020.054  ± 0.0030.060  ± 0.0040.047  ± 0.0010.058  ± 0.003
SI0.102  ± 0.0150.039  ± 0.0030.039  ± 0.0020.063  ± 0.0020.083  ± 0.0020.077  ± 0.003
Liver0.125  ± 0.0080.026  ± 0.0030.031  ± 0.0010.030  ± 0.0040.037  ± 0.0020.048  ± 0.002
  • Apparent tissue uptake clearance (CLup,app) of sugar-introduced AVP derivatives by various rat tissues. 3H-labeled AVP and derivatives were administrated at a dose of 1 nmol/kg. CLup,app was calculated by the total radio activity. BM and SI represent bone marrow and small intestine, respectively. Values represent means ± S.E. of three rats.
